Born on November 29, 1997, in Chennai, Tamil Nadu, Yuvarani began her acting career as a child artist in the Tamil film industry. She gained recognition for her roles in films like "Thirumanam Ennum Nikkah" and "Vellaikaara Durai." As she transitioned to leading roles, Yuvarani's fashion sense became an integral part of her on-screen persona.
